## Service Accounts — Driftgate Realtime

While investigating the websocket reconnect bug (clients re-handshaking every 30 seconds after a load-balancer failover), we confirmed the reconnect path uses the shared `driftgate-relay` service account rather than per-session tokens. This matters because reconnect storms can exhaust that account's rate budget, which is what triggered the cascading disconnects last Tuesday. For local reproduction, point your client at the staging relay and authenticate with the service-account key below.

gateway credential: kto23_LX9A4ys6i4nzHtpOLNLodKK

Ticket: temp site access — night shift. While the Harlowden Annex is torn apart for renovation, we've shifted operations to the portacabin cluster in the rear yard off Grayme Street. Night crew: the main annex doors are sealed, so don't bother with your usual fobs. Use the yard gate, then the second cabin on the left — that's the ops room. The keypad on the cabin door takes the code below.

staff pass of bafog-kajop = bdg-VL-3

**CI Troubleshooting: vendored font checksum failures**

If the Thornlace CI job fails at the `verify-fonts` stage, the vendored font files under `third_party/fonts/` no longer match their pinned checksums. This usually means someone updated a font without regenerating the manifest. Run the `refresh-font-manifest` script locally, confirm the license file still covers the new versions, and commit both together. To confirm you are debugging the same run the alert references, compare against the build identifier shown below.

session token of bagep-yaduf = htk6_9cf8de